| JTEC RADIOWAVE ![]() | I completely agree with what Tank said. Sponsors will come to you when the time is right. In my experience most of the time you sponsor come from companies that you already deal with and have a good knowledge of there product. But remember getting sponsored isnt everything, this is your hobby and you choose it for a reason. Oh yeah the other thing is just because you are sponsored doesnt mean you get stuff for free.

| Bad-ass Super Contributer! ![]() | Sponsorship is an interesting deal. I have a few although I am not one of the best pilots you'll find. Most have come to me as a result of willingness to try new stuff, along with the ability to give feedback on a regular basis (in a respectful informative way). One thing sponsors HATE is sending a guy free stuff and never hearing anything back. I do quite a bit along the lines of helping people who are new to the hobby or expierenced pilots who need a little help with something they are not so familiar with. Always be willing to help out when you can. As Biff mentioned the other day, it is a BAD BAD BAD idea to get into "Brand Bashing", always be positive and repectful to those who choose other products than you do. Last but not least, get out and fly at as many events as you have time for. Each year I fly a two or three full scale shows, about 5 "Fly-Ins", and about 3 IMAC contest. Get out to the events and learn who the people are and let them know who your are. Most of all, HAVE FUN.
